- W2000844028 abstract "This paper estimates the relative efficiency of locally-controlled urban collective and provincially-controlled state-owned enterprises in the Chinese construction industry between 1985 and 1988, a period following significant economic reforms. A generalized restricted translog cost function approach is used which allows for both fixed and variable factor choices to deviate from profit-maximizing outcomes. Results indicate that collectives were less efficient in this sample than state-owned enterprises in the use of variable inputs, and this gap was not closing by 1988. State-owned enterprises were, however, much less efficient in the use of capital, even when the measure of capital is adjusted for a relatively higher percentage of nonproductive investment. For both sectors of Chinese construction, the growth rate of total factor productivity (or average technical efficiency) rose to approximately four percent per year by 1988, but this improvement did not extend to more cost-efficient combinations of inputs." @default.
